Clases De Software
Enviado por pio2 • 10 de Noviembre de 2012 • 938 Palabras (4 Páginas) • 678 Visitas
4. Clases de Software El grupo deberá realizar una investigación exhaustiva sobre Software, posteriormente deberán identificar mediante un cuadro comparativo las características propias (Seguridad, Escalabilidad, etc.) del Software Licenciado y el Software Libre.
Software de Aplicación: aquí se incluyen todos aquellos programas que permiten al usuario realizar una o varias tareas específicas. Aquí se encuentran aquellos programas que los individuos usan de manera cotidiana como: procesadores de texto, hojas de cálculo, editores, telecomunicaciones, software de cálculo numérico y simbólico, videojuegos, entre otros.
Software de Programacion: Son aquellas herramientas que un programador utiliza para poder desarrollar programas informáticos. Para esto el programador se vale de distintos lenguajes de programación, como por ejemplo se pueden tomar compiladores, programas de diseño asistido por computador paquetes integrados, editores de texto, enlazadores, depuradores, interpretes, entre otros.
Software de Sistemas: Es aquel que permite a los usuarios interactuar con el sistema operativo asi como también controlarlo. Este sistema esta compuesto por una serie de programas que tienen como objetivo administrar los recursos de hardware y al mismo tiempo, le otorgan al usuario una interfaz. El sistema operativo permite facilitar la utilización del ordenador a sus usuarios ya que es el que le d la posibilidad de asignar y administrar los recursos del sistema, como por ejemplo de esta clase de software se puede mencionar a Windows, Linux y Mar OS X, entre otros. Ademas de los sistemas operativos dentro del software de sistema se ubican las herramientas de diagnosticos, los servidores, las utilidades, controladores de dispositivos y las herramientas de corrección y optimización.
Software libre.
Mantenemos esta definición de software libre para mostrar claramente qué debe cumplir un programa de software concreto para que se le considere software libre.
El ``Software Libre'' es un asunto de libertad, no de precio. Para entender el concepto, debes pensar en ``libre'' como en ``libertad de expresión'', no como en ``cerveza gratis'' [N. del T.: en inglés una misma palabra (free) significa tanto libre como gratis, lo que ha dado lugar a cierta confusión].
``Software Libre'' se refiere a la libertad de los usuarios para ejecutar, copiar, distribuir, estudiar, cambiar y mejorar el software. De modo más preciso, se refiere a cuatro libertades de los usuarios del software:
• La libertad de usar el programa, con cualquier propósito (libertad 0).
• La libertad de estudiar cómo funciona el programa, y adaptarlo a tus necesidades (libertad 1). El acceso al código fuente es una condición previa para esto.
• La libertad de distribuir copias, con lo que puedes ayudar a tu vecino (libertad 2).
• La libertad de mejorar el programa y hacer públicas las mejoras a los demás, de modo que toda la comunidad se beneficie. (libertad 3). El acceso al código fuente es un requisito previo para esto.
Un programa es software libre si los usuarios
...